  6. Personally, I prefer blue cheddar, brie, camembert, or, if not available, even Harzer Stinkkaese, each to suit his own taste,
    probably have had my fill of the hard cheeses in a prior period of life ????  

    Having said that, Gouda and the like may have some salt and possibly mold on the waxed outside. Prior to the cheese being cut, wash it off, and all good.
    However, if there is mold on a cut cheese, spores have likely spread all over the piece , so either cut off all open sides, or toss it in the bin. 
    this kind of moldy cheese is not recommended for animals either.
